High-voltage circuit breakers play a crucial role in power systems, undertaking both control and protection tasks. Their performance directly impacts the safe operation of the power system, and the mechanical characteristic parameters of circuit breakers are among the most important parameters for judging their performance. Our company's Switchgear Tester can accurately measure the mechanical operating characteristic parameters of high-voltage circuit breakers of various voltage levels, including oil-less, oil-filled, vacuum, and sulfur hexafluoride circuit breakers.

Application Scenarios

 

The Switchgear Tester can be used to test the operating characteristic parameters of SF6 switches, GIS switchgear, vacuum switches, oil switches, vacuum contactors, and special circuit breakers, such as train circuit breakers, manufactured both domestically and internationally. It effectively prevents power failures caused by performance issues before and after the use of high-voltage circuit breakers.

Features

 

The Switchgear Tester Can simultaneously test 12 channels of metal contact breakage, 6 channels of main breakage, and 6 channels of auxiliary breakage.

01

During testing, only one circuit breaker trip is needed to acquire data and waveforms such as time, number of trips and their duration, speed, coil current, and coil resistance.

02

Features energy storage, automatic and manual low-trip testing, circuit breaker life testing, and power supply interlocking functions.

03

7-inch color high-brightness screen with adjustable brightness, clearly visible even in sunlight.

04

Internal menu-driven operation guide, each test interface can be operated with one click, supports Chinese and English input, and is simple to operate and fast to test.

When grounding the instrument in the field, why should the grounding wire be connected first, and then the break point wire connected?

+

-

Because during field testing, the break point of a high-voltage switch (especially above 220kV) often has a very high induced voltage between the break point and ground. While the voltage value is large and the energy is relatively small, it is sufficient to threaten the safety of the instrument itself. Internally, the instrument has a discharge circuit between the break point signal input terminal and ground. Therefore, grounding the wire first prioritizes connecting the discharge circuit. When the break signal line is connected at this point, even if a high voltage is induced at the break point, it can be discharged to ground through the discharge circuit, thus ensuring the safety of the instrument's break channel.
